目录
- 什么是 shadowsocks manyuser?
- 安装前准备
- 在 Windows 上安装 shadowsocks manyuser
- 在 macOS 上安装 shadowsocks manyuser
- 在 Linux 上安装 shadowsocks manyuser
- 常见问题解答
什么是 shadowsocks manyuser?
Shadowsocks 是一种基于 SOCKS5 代理的加密传输协议,被广泛用于突破网络审查和实现科学上网。 Shadowsocks manyuser 是在原有 Shadowsocks 基础上开发的多用户管理系统,支持更灵活的配置和管理。
与传统的 Shadowsocks 相比,Shadowsocks manyuser 具有以下优势:
- 支持多用户管理,可以为不同用户设置不同的配置
- 提供管理后台,可以方便地添加、删除和查看用户信息
- 支持流量统计和限制,可以更好地管理网络资源
- 可以自定义加密算法和端口,提高安全性
安装前准备
在安装 Shadowsocks manyuser 之前,您需要准备以下内容:
- 一台可以访问互联网的服务器或虚拟主机
- 一个域名(可选,用于设置自定义域名)
- 一些基本的 Linux 操作知识
在 Windows 上安装 shadowsocks manyuser
- 下载 Shadowsocks manyuser 客户端软件,可以在官方网站下载最新版本。
- 解压缩下载的 ZIP 文件,并运行 Shadowsocks.exe 程序。
- 在客户端软件中,点击左上角的 “+”,选择 “Shadowsocks Config”。
- 在弹出的窗口中,填写服务器地址、端口、密码和加密方式等信息,然后点击 “OK” 保存。
- 在主界面中,选择刚刚添加的服务器,并点击 “Connect” 按钮开始使用。
在 macOS 上安装 shadowsocks manyuser
-
打开终端应用程序,并运行以下命令安装 Homebrew:
bash /usr/bin/ruby -e “$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)”
-
安装 Shadowsocks-libev 软件包:
bash brew install shadowsocks-libev
-
创建一个 Shadowsocks 配置文件,例如
~/shadowsocks.json
,并填写服务器地址、端口、密码和加密方式等信息。 -
在终端中运行以下命令启动 Shadowsocks 客户端:
bash sslocal -c ~/shadowsocks.json
-
配置系统代理,将 SOCKS5 代理地址设置为
127.0.0.1:1080
。
在 Linux 上安装 shadowsocks manyuser
-
打开终端应用程序,并根据您的 Linux 发行版安装 Shadowsocks-libev 软件包:
-
Debian/Ubuntu:
bash apt-get update apt-get install shadowsocks-libev
-
CentOS/RHEL:
bash yum install epel-release yum install shadowsocks-libev
-
Arch Linux:
bash pacman -S shadowsocks-libev
-
-
创建一个 Shadowsocks 配置文件,例如
/etc/shadowsocks-libev/config.json
,并填写服务器地址、端口、密码和加密方式等信息。 -
启动 Shadowsocks 服务:
bash systemctl start shadowsocks-libev
-
配置系统代理,将 SOCKS5 代理地址设置为
127.0.0.1:1080
。
常见问题解答
1. Shadowsocks 和 Shadowsocks manyuser 有什么区别?
Shadowsocks 是一种基于 SOCKS5 代理的加密传输协议,而 Shadowsocks manyuser 是在原有 Shadowsocks 基础上开发的多用户管理系统,提供了更灵活的配置和管理功能。
2. Shadowsocks manyuser 如何实现多用户管理?
Shadowsocks manyuser 提供了管理后台,可以方便地添加、删除和查看用户信息。管理员可以为不同用户设置不同的配置,包括服务器地址、端口、密码和加密方式等。
3. Shadowsocks manyuser 如何统计和限制流量?
Shadowsocks manyuser 支持流量统计和限制功能,管理员可以查看每个用户的流量使用情况,并设置流量限制,以更好地管理网络资源。
4. 如何提高 Shadowsocks manyuser 的安全性?
您可以通过以下方式提高 Shadowsocks manyuser 的安全性:
- 使用强密码
- 设置自定义端口
- 选择安全的加密算法
- 定期更新 Shadowsocks 客户端和服务端软件
- 配合其他安全工具,如 V2Ray 或 Trojan
5. 如果遇到 Shadowsocks manyuser 无法连接的问题,应该如何解决?
如果遇到 Shadowsocks manyuser 无法连接的问题,可以尝试以下步骤:
- 检查服务器地址、端口、密码和加密方式是否正确
- 检查防火墙是否阻止了 Shadowsocks 的连接
- 尝试更换加密算法或端口
- 检查服务器是否正常运行
- 更新 Shadowsocks 客户端和服务端软件到最新版本